Kuala Lumpur Office is part of Marriott International, a leading global lodging company with more than 7,000 properties across 131 countries and territories. Known for its commitment to exceptional service and innovative guest experiences, Marriott offers a wide range of hospitality brands, from luxury to select service. The company values diversity and inclusion, providing opportunities for career growth and development in a dynamic and supportive environment.
Malaysia is a vibrant country with a rich cultural heritage and diverse job opportunities, especially in hospitality, finance, and technology sectors. The lifestyle is a blend of traditional and modern influences, offering a variety of cuisines, festivals, and recreational activities. English is widely spoken, making it easier for expatriates to adapt. The cost of living is relatively affordable compared to other Asian countries. Malaysia offers various visa options for skilled workers, and the process is generally straightforward. Relocation support is often provided by employers, making it an attractive destination for professionals seeking career advancement in a multicultural setting.
